Dark Air-Cured Kentucky Fire-Cured Tobacco

This is a specific type of dark air-cured tobacco grown in Kentucky, threshed and processed for use in pipe tobacco blends or chewing tobacco. It falls under HTS 2401.20.83.40 as it is partly stemmed, threshed dark-air cured Kentucky and Tennessee tobacco designated for products other than cigarettes. The bold, smoky flavor profile makes it ideal for non-cigarette tobacco products.

Import Tips & Compliance

Verify origin documentation to confirm Kentucky/Tennessee dark air-cured type and non-cigarette end use to avoid reclassification

Check U.S. aggregate tobacco import quotas under Additional U.S

Note 5; exceedances may trigger higher duties

Provide FDA prior notice and ensure no pesticide residues exceed EPA tolerances for unmanufactured tobacco
